diff --git a/sh_scripts/cloudserver_auto_repos.sh b/sh_scripts/cloudserver_auto_repos.sh index 33cf460..0065281 100644 --- a/sh_scripts/cloudserver_auto_repos.sh +++ b/sh_scripts/cloudserver_auto_repos.sh @@ -23,7 +23,7 @@ echo "" echo "" echo "" echo "LETS GO!" - +apt update apt install curl wget apt-transport-https dirmngr neofetch htop nload git -y echo " #------------------------------------------------------------------------------# diff --git a/sh_scripts/prometheus.sh b/sh_scripts/prometheus.sh index 4459594..f92ab2d 100644 --- a/sh_scripts/prometheus.sh +++ b/sh_scripts/prometheus.sh @@ -41,8 +41,7 @@ tar xvf prometheus*.tar.gz cd prometheus*/ sudo mv prometheus promtool /usr/local/bin/ sudo mv prometheus.yml /etc/prometheus/prometheus.yml -sudo tee /etc/prometheus/prometheus.yml< /etc/prometheus/prometheus.yml +sudo echo " [Unit] Description=Prometheus Documentation=https://prometheus.io/docs/introduction/overview/ @@ -106,7 +103,8 @@ WantedBy=multi-user.target EOF; done for i in rules rules.d files_sd; do sudo chown -R prometheus:prometheus /etc/prometheus/${i}; done for i in rules rules.d files_sd; do sudo chmod -R 775 /etc/prometheus/${i}; done -sudo chown -R prometheus:prometheus /var/lib/prometheus/ +sudo chown -R prometheus:prometheus /var/lib/prometheus/" > /etc/systemd/system/prometheus.service + echo "Install Node_Exporter" curl -s https://api.github.com/repos/prometheus/node_exporter/releases/latest \ @@ -119,7 +117,7 @@ tar -xvf node_exporter*.tar.gz cd node_exporter*/ sudo cp node_exporter /usr/local/bin -sudo tee /etc/systemd/system/node_exporter.service < /etc/systemd/system/node_exporter.service + sudo systemctl daemon-reload sudo systemctl start node_exporter sudo systemctl start prometheus